The Glymphatic System: A Newly Recognized Hero
Discovered only in 2012, the glymphatic system acts as a waste removal mechanism, facilitating the movement of cerebrospinal fluid (CSF) throughout the brain. This flow is essential for flushing out toxins that can accumulate and potentially lead to conditions such as Alzheimer's disease. Advancements like MRI imaging have allowed researchers to study this system at an unprecedented scale, involving nearly 40,000 participants from the UK Biobank.
Professor Hugh Markus and his team discovered that specific biomarkers related to glymphatic function predicted dementia risk up to a decade in advance. Among these indicators, conditions affecting the cerebral small vessels and cardiovascular health were notably detrimental, amplifying risks associated with dementia.
The Role of Cardiovascular Health in Cognitive Decline
Individuals with high blood pressure or who smoke may unknowingly exacerbate the impairment of the glymphatic system. This potential link underscores the importance of managing cardiovascular health. As Professor Markus suggested, interventions to lower blood pressure or reduce smoking could improve glymphatic function and potentially lower dementia risk.

The Future of Dementia Research
The findings from Cambridge not only provide insight into dementia risk factors but also pave the way for future preventive measures. Researchers propose exploring pharmaceutical pathways that could enhance glymphatic function.
